I tested and detected some interesting things:
- When CC is called the control (start/stop/pause) of B4A ide is lost
- The log continues...
- Activity is paused and start again after selection with isfirst = true (wrong...)
- When succeed, the event is generated... when fail, the activity is resumed but without data
During experiences I could fell some interaction between the timing of touch (slow/fast) and event capture success... maybe I´m wrong, but I think no.
That´s it.
Thanks
Ps: sorry the delay answering - I was out of my office yesterday... the solution of this issue is #VERY# important for us - like I told this is the "entry point" of our clients in our apps (profile photo).
LogCat connected to: B4A-Bridge: LGE LG-P920-357854040145426
--------- beginning of /dev/log/system
--------- beginning of /dev/log/main
startService: class anywheresoftware.b4a.samples.httputils2.httputils2service
** Service (httputils2service) Create ** '###### activity start
** Service (httputils2service) Start **
** Activity (cadastro) Pause, UserClosed = false ** '###### CC called and gallery open
** Activity (cadastro1) Create, isFirst = true ** '####### Gallery selection/activity return
** Activity (cadastro1) Resume **
** Activity (cadastro1) Pause, UserClosed = false ** '### Many times without event...
** Activity (cadastro1) Create, isFirst = true **
** Activity (cadastro1) Resume **
** Activity (cadastro1) Pause, UserClosed = false **
** Activity (cadastro1) Create, isFirst = true **
** Activity (cadastro1) Resume **
** Activity (cadastro1) Pause, UserClosed = false **
** Activity (cadastro1) Create, isFirst = true **
** Activity (cadastro1) Resume **
** Activity (cadastro1) Pause, UserClosed = false ** '### TRY AGAIN... AGAIN... SUCCESS
sending message to waiting queue (OnActivityResult)
running waiting messages (1)
CC_result -> true Dir -> ContentDir Filename -> content://media/external/images/media/103293
** Activity (cadastro1) Resume **
** Activity (cadastro1) Pause, UserClosed = false **